Although +3 oxidation states is the characteristic oxidation state of lanthanoids but cerium shows +4 oxidation state also. Why?
उत्तर
The electronic configuration of \[\ce{Ce is -4f^1 5d^1 6s^2}\]. Usually 5d’ and 6s2 electrons are lost by the lanthanoids in their reactions i.e., they exhibit +3 oxidation states. But Ce exhibit +4 oxidation state also because it gains extra stability by losing 4f1 electron because it will give rise to completely filled orbitals.
